Texel Air Australasia scores a world first ETOPS milestone
A Boeing ‘Tweet’ revealed that to Texel Air Australasia has completed the world's first extended operations (ETOPS) flight with a Boeing 737-800BCF.

Boeing’s congratulatory tweet read: “Hats off to Texel Air Australasia on completing the world’s first extended operations (ETOPS) flight on a 737-800 Boeing Converted Freighter (BCF)! ETOPS will open new routes for the 737-800BCF that were previously out of range and enable more efficient flight paths.”
Texel Air Australasia is a subsidiary of Bahrain-based cargo airline Texel Air and is a cargo airline established in New Zealand in March 2023. As of 8 April 2024 the airline has four Boeing 737-800BCF aircraft in its fleet, while the Bahrain operation has one, alongside examples of the Boeing 737-300F, and the Boing 737-700FC (FlexCombi).
